Frequently Asked Questions

Where can I park to access the Tojeira (Green) trail?

The trail is located within Tapada Nacional de Mafra. Parking is available at the main entrance of the park, which serves as the primary access point for all routes, including the Tojeira (Green) trail.

Are dogs allowed on the Tojeira (Green) trail?

No, dogs are generally not permitted inside Tapada Nacional de Mafra to protect the diverse wildlife within the park. It's best to leave your furry friends at home for this particular adventure.

What is the best time of year to jog this trail?

The trail can be enjoyed year-round, but for optimal conditions and wildlife spotting, consider visiting during spring or autumn. If jogging in summer, be aware that some sections, particularly the gentler descent, are more exposed to the sun. Dusk is often the best time to see animals in the pasture areas.

Do I need a permit or pay an entrance fee for Tapada Nacional de Mafra?

Yes, as the Tojeira (Green) trail is located within Tapada Nacional de Mafra, there is typically an entrance fee to access the park. It's advisable to check the official Tapada Nacional de Mafra website for current pricing and any specific permit requirements for activities.

Is this trail suitable for beginners or families with small children?

While rated as 'moderate' and suitable for all skill levels for jogging, its varied topography and terrain make it unsuitable for families with small children in prams or pushchairs. Joggers should have a good level of fitness due to the elevation changes.

How long does it typically take to jog this trail?

For jogging, the estimated duration for the 8.58 km route is around 1 hour and 6 minutes. If you prefer to hike, it can take between 2 to 3 hours.

What kind of terrain and scenery can I expect along the route?

You'll experience a diverse landscape, including mostly paved surfaces, mixed forest, pine forest, scrubland, and pasture areas. The route offers rich and varied scenery with beautiful views from higher elevations.

What notable features or landmarks are along the route?

The trail is set within the historic Tapada Nacional de Mafra,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. You can also spot the Lime Kiln of Tapada de Mafra and a unique volcanic chimney with visible black basalt rock veins.

What wildlife might I see on the trail?

The park is home to diverse wildlife. Keep an eye out for emblematic animals such as deer, fallow deer, and wild boars, especially in the pasture areas, particularly at dusk when herds are more active.

Does this trail connect with other routes in Tapada Nacional de Mafra?

Yes, the Tojeira (Green) trail covers 94% of the official 'Percurso Tojeira (verde)' route. It also intersects with sections of other trails within the park, such as 'Percurso Taipas (vermelho)' and 'Percurso Boavista (amarelo)'.
